Botsing, a Search-based Crash Reproduction Framework for Java

Approaches for automatic crash reproduction aim to generate test cases that reproduce crashes starting from the crash stack traces. These tests help developers during their debugging practices. One of the most promising techniques in this research …

Search-based Crash Reproduction using Behavioral Model Seeding

Search-based crash reproduction approaches assist developers during debugging by generating a test case, which reproduces a crash given its stack trace. One of the fundamental steps of this approach is creating objects needed to trigger the crash. …
